About:

Bandit Kings of Ancient China is a turn-based strategy role-playing simulation game developed and published by Koei for MS-Dos, the Amiga, and the Apple II. It was later ported to the Nintendo Entertainment System and a number of other platforms, including a re-release in 1996 on the Sega Saturn and Sony PlayStation. It was well-received at its inception, and was considered to be a significant step forward in the complexity of strategy gaming.

Story:

The game is based on the novel Water Margin, and takes place in ancient China during the reign of Emperor Huizong of the Song Dynasty. The player fights with the ten bandits to build, sustain, and command an army of troops to eventually capture the evil Gao Qiu, China's Minister of War, before the Jurchen invasion occurs in January 1127. Economic controls are also available, including taxes and troop unrest.
